Original Description
Achille Laugé's La Route à l'Entree de Cailhavel is a luminous celebration of light and rural serenity, capturing a sun-dappled country path framed by slender trees. Painted in the late 19th or early 20th century, this work exemplifies Laugé's Neo-Impressionist style, where meticulous pointillist brushwork blends into harmonious vibrancy from afar. A lesser-known but vital figure of Post-Impressionism, Laugé diverged from Seurat’s rigid scientific approach, infusing his landscapes with a poetic, spontaneous quality inspired by his native Occitanie. The painting’s delicate play of light—filtering through foliage onto the winding road—evokes tranquility while showcasing his mastery of color theory. Though overshadowed by contemporaries like Signac, Laugé’s works are now reevaluated for their bridge between Impressionist spontaneity and Divisionist precision, making La Route... a gem for collectors of transitional modernist movements.
